Cooperative Beamforming in Relay Assisted MIMO-OFDMA Cognitive Radio Systems

Abstract:
Cognitive radio (CR) technology can effectively improve spectral efficiency by allowing secondary users (SUs) to access licensed bands without any harmful interference to primary users (PUs). Due to adverse effects of environment such as loss and fading, SUs may receive weak signals. So, in order to mitigate these effects, some SUs can act as relay nodes to improve SUs’ connectivity. Moreover, using relay nodes can increase spatial diversity and also enhance spectrum efficiency further. In this paper, a new algorithm is proposed for cooperative beamforming, power allocation and relay selection in the multiple input multiple output (MIMO) Orthogonal Frequency Division Multiple Access (OFDMA) CR systems where a pair of SU communicates with each other assisted by some single antenna relay nodes. The objective is to maximize signal to interference plus noise ratio (SINR) of SU subject to guarantee the PU's quality of service and power constraints of SU and relay nodes over all subchannels. The transmitter and receiver beamforming vectors of PU and SU are estimated by the proposed two-step iterative algorithm. The performance of the algorithm is evaluated through simulations. Simulation results show that the proposed algorithm, in addition to guarantee a required performance of the PU, increases spectrum usage efficiency by servicing the SUs. Also, by increasing the number of relay nodes, the performance of the algorithm is improved
